Output 561ec6c9b8439f8229b45e403077b3838c9f8a09b755ff8b288327920b50d6ee:4

value
1351076
script pubkey
OP_0 OP_PUSHBYTES_20 d41fd45561a9f298407dfe2489e5e3463de7481a
address
bc1q6s0ag4tp48efssralcjgne0rgc77wjq6w7xh5e
transaction
561ec6c9b8439f8229b45e403077b3838c9f8a09b755ff8b288327920b50d6ee
confirmations
104315
spent
true